2. Freelance Writing
When I started writing I had no idea that I can make money from it. Once my own blogs were in place and I gained some experience, I started writing for company blogs. I was a regular writer for a VoIP company back in 2014. As you can see the below screenshot I was charging $4 per article which has increased to 25-30x now. Being in college $4 (approx. INR 200) per article was not bad. I used to write 6-8 articles a week. You can signup at Contentmart and start accepting offers right away.
3. Virtual Internships
You can make good money amount by doing virtual internships, where you don’t need to go to an office or do any field tasks. On an average, a month long internship pays a stipend of around INR 3000 to INR 5000, and can be higher depending on the company you’re interning for.
There are many websites like LetsIntern, Twenty19 where you can find these virtual internship opportunities.

7. Rent Your Stuff
Instead of selling, you can also rent your stuff that you rarely use. I’ve a DSLR camera which I rent out on OLX and make a couple of thousand rupees per month. If you’ve anything that you think can be rented out then list it on the website and enjoy some extra pocket money.
8. Rent Your Place On AirBnB
I’ve a friend who lives in a 2 BHK apartment in Bangalore and rents his room on AirBnB for few hundred rupees a night. He mostly rents it to solo travellers who need cheap accommodation for a day or two.
If you have an apartment or flat then renting it out on AirBnB, GoIbibo or MMT (as a homestay) is not a bad idea.

10. Drop Shipping
I know a couple of college students who sell t-shirts online and make good money from it. They don’t maintain any inventory. They have partnered with some third party vendors in their areas. Once they get an order, it gets forwarded to the vendor and the vendor then ships the item to the buyer with custom branding.
